BE DRIVEN: 35-year-old Dr Zikhona Tywabi-Ngeva is an
academic, scientist and philanthropist from Queenstown
in the Eastern Cape. Her day job is that of a Physical
Chemistry Lecturer and Researcher at the Nelson
Mandela University. She’s the founder of an NGO which
gives career guidance to those under-prepared for
tertiary education. She also runs her own waste
management company. She joins us on the line.
